About the Item

The 1945 original poster by Bouchenaf for Vol à Voile Sport Sans Rival created for the Fédération Nationale des Sports Aériens is a testament to the post-war fascination with aviation and the burgeoning interest in air sports. This poster not only advertises the thrill of gliding but also serves as a patriotic call to embrace aviation as a symbol of freedom and innovation in the rebuilding years following World War II. In the immediate aftermath of the war, aviation captured the public's imagination as both a symbol of technological progress and a means of personal liberation. Gliding, or vol à voile, emerged as a particularly popular sport, offering a peaceful contrast to the militarized use of aircraft during the war. The Fédération Nationale des Sports Aériens, an organization dedicated to promoting aerial sports, sought to harness this enthusiasm and encourage public participation in this serene yet exhilarating activity. Original Poster Aviation - Sport - Aeronautics National Air Sports Federation Printed by Henri Francois in Paris
